    Yep, literally hold the fish in a washcloth face up and drop the med right in the mouth when they go to take a breathe. Not too hard since the bottle tip is pointed like an eye dropper. None of mine would eat it in the tank. I think I did 5 drops twice a day for three days. Wait for it to settle in and then return fish to tank. I've also soaked bits in it and then everyone gets some if I see any white waste.
